Maison d'Animation Populaire de Sorel Incorporee is a charitable organization based in Sorel-Tracy, Quebec, classified by the CRA under community resource organizations. In its fiscal year ending June 30, 2024, it reported $137K in revenue and $120K in expenditures.
Its funding that year was roughly 77% from donations, 19% from government. In 2024, 1 other registered charity reported granting it a combined $5,000.
Compared with 730 community-service charities of similar size, its share of spending on mission — charitable programs plus grants to other charities — ranked above 87% of peers. None of its ten highest-paid positions cleared $40,000. The charity reported 1 permanent full-time position.
It reported gifts to 4 qualified donees totalling $81K in 2024, the largest being $50K to Groupe d'entraide leGESTE. Revenue has grown substantially over its filings on record here, from $50K in 2020 to $137K in 2024. Its filed list of directors and trustees shows 5 names.
In its own words
La Maison d’animation populaire de Sorel met toutes ses ressources au service des autres groupes communautaires et groupe d’économie sociale du territoire de la MRC Pierre De-Saurel. Plus particulièrement nous avons développé et supportons un programme continue de formation pour les administrateurs le personnel et les bénévoles des groupes visés. De plus nous mettons gratuitement à la disposition de ces groupes un local qui est une salle multi-média pouvant accueillir près de 20 personnes tout le long de l’année. Nous accueillons également dans nos locaux des groupes en développement et ce…
Ongoing-program description from its T3010 filing, verbatim.
The ledger, 2020–2024
| Year | Revenue | Spending | Programs | Fundraising | Gifts out | Net assets |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2024 | $137K | $120K | $37K | — | $81K | $228K |
| 2023 | $43K | $42K | $40K | — | $600 | $211K |
| 2022 | $40K | $46K | $44K | — | $600 | $211K |
| 2021 | $76K | $50K | $27K | — | $11K | $216K |
| 2020 | $50K | $55K | — | — | $600 | $190K |
Revenue printed in red where the year ran a deficit. Fiscal years by period end.
